Why homes in Botany need coastal-aware painting systems

The appeal of Botany 2019 comes from its Georges River foreshore setting, with established family homes, waterfront apartments offering river views, and properties with direct water access defining its residential character. This same location also changes the way Botany properties need to be painted. Salt air from the Georges River, supported by coastal exposure from Botany Bay to the north, creates harsher conditions for exterior paint than homes in inland Sydney suburbs. Gloss loss, chalking, and early adhesion problems can develop faster in Botany than in suburbs 5–10 kilometres inland. If a painter uses a standard exterior topcoat without specifying for salt-air exposure, the result may need repainting in 3–4 years rather than lasting the 7–10 years a suitable system should deliver.

Salt air and exterior paint in Botany, what homeowners should know

The salt air from Georges River carries tiny salt crystals that settle on painted surfaces when rain is not washing them away. These crystals are hygroscopic, meaning they draw moisture from the air and can create a damp layer under fresh paint if surfaces are not properly cleaned before repainting. This is why simple repaints on Botany homes, without careful sugar soap washing and correct primer application, often lead to early chalking, blistering, or adhesion failure within 2 years. Why Botany decking and outdoor areas need salt and sun protection

Botany waterfront character places outdoor living areas at the centre of many renovation projects, especially decks, pergolas, balconies, and pool surrounds. These surfaces must withstand both intense sunlight and salt air. Timber decking on Georges River-facing properties can grey and chalk faster than inland timber, and painted metal surfaces around pools, including fencing and handrails, can corrode more quickly. Why choosing the right paint matters more in Botany than inland Sydney

Neither of the main competitors locally addresses this issue. Magic Touch selects paint products by exposure zone, with coastal-rated systems used where salt air demands stronger protection.

Waterfront-facing coastal exposure

Botany homes facing the Georges River or Botany Bay need exterior coatings made for harsher conditions. We specify coastal-rated systems with built-in resistance to UV exposure and salt air.

Durable exterior finishes with Dulux Weathershield Max, Taubmans All Weather, and Wattyl Solagard

Covered outdoor surfaces

Inland-facing walls, areas protected by eaves, and sheltered courtyard surfaces can tolerate premium standard exterior acrylic, although they still need thorough sugar soap cleaning and priming before repainting.

Dulux Wash & Wear Exterior and Taubmans Endure Exterior

Managing coastal humidity inside the home

Because Bayside homes can experience slightly higher ambient humidity, bathrooms and kitchens need the right interior paint system. We specify moisture-resistant paint for wet areas and low-sheen finishes rather than flat paint for walls requiring regular cleaning.

Trusted interior finishes from Dulux Aquanamel, Taubmans Allcoat Interior, and Dulux Wash & Wear
